The board gaming world is preparing to welcome a new strategic game : Camboya. Designed and illustrated by artist Jorge Tabanera Redondo and published by Tranjis Games, this title transports players to the heart of Cambodia, into an ecosystem where life is dictated by the rising waters of Lake Tonlé Sap.
An Immersive Theme: Building Against the Inevitable
In Camboya, the theme is more than just decoration. The monsoon is approaching, and the water levels are about to rise drastically. Each player leads a local family that must brace itself for the imminent floods.
The challenge is significant: you must build palafitos (stilt houses) and secure your food reserves before the rising waters wash everything away. It is a true “Eurogame” of management and survival where adaptation is the key to success.
Gameplay Mechanics: The Elegance of the Draft
The heart of the experience lies in a fluid and tactical dice drafting system. Each round, the dice you select determine the actions available to your family members:
-
The Explorer: Ventures deep into the mangroves to gather bamboo, bananas, and essential provisions.
-
The Pilgrims: Travel along spiritual routes toward temples to increase your family’s influence.
-
The Villager: Climbs the ranks of the village’s Prestige board to unlock crucial strategic advantages.
Strategy and Modularity
One of the game’s greatest strengths is its modularity. Thanks to a variable setup of the mangroves and pilgrimage routes, every game presents a unique puzzle.
With the materials gathered, you must make critical choices: build boats for mobility, or invest in towering stilt structures to keep your fish safe from the fearsome floods. Anticipation is vital; spending one too many turns gathering without securing your goods could prove fatal.
Technical Specifications
-
Designer & Artist: Jorge Tabanera Redondo
-
Publisher: Tranjis Games
-
Players: 2 to 4
-
Age: 10+
-
Duration: Approximately 45 minutes
-
Release Year: 2026
